Gerrard new coach for Nakamba Steven Gerrard

LIVERPOOL legend Steven Gerrard is Zimbabwe international Marvelous Nakamba’s new coach at English Premiership football club Aston Villa.

Gerrard replaces Dean Smith who was relieved of his duties at the weekend.

Smith, who was fired after three years at the helm, signed Nakamba from Belgian side, Club Brugge, in 2019.

But the Zimbabwean will start a new life under Gerrard, who is a cult hero among many Zimbabweans who are Liverpool fanatics.

The former England midfielder leaves Scottish champions Rangers to sign a deal at Villa Park.

The Athletic reported on Wednesday that Gerrard was on the verge of becoming Villa head coach.

Steven Gerrard said: “Aston Villa is a club with a rich history and tradition in English football and I am immensely proud to become its new head coach.

“In my conversations with Nassef, Wes, and the rest of the board, it was apparent how ambitious their plans are for the club and I am looking forward to helping them achieve their aims.

“I would like to express my sincere gratitude to everybody associated with Glasgow Rangers for giving me the opportunity to manage such an iconic football club. Helping them secure a record-breaking 55th league title will always hold a special place in my heart. I would like to wish the players, staff, and supporters the very best for the future.”

Gerrard takes over a Villa side that sit 16th in the Premier League, having lost their last five matches since a 1-0 win over Manchester United at Old Trafford on September 25.

The 41-year-old’s first game in charge will be a home fixture against Brighton & Hove Albion on November 20.

Gerrard, a former Liverpool captain, and Champions League winner, took over at Rangers in June 2018 in what was his first managerial role. He guided the Glasgow side to two second-place finishes before delivering a first league title in 10 years in 2020-21. – Sports Reporter/The Athletic
